Analysis

In 2021, communicable diseases — communicable disease incidence in Brazil stood at 35,246 Cases.

The figure is up 15.0% on the previous year and down 18.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, communicable diseases — communicable disease incidence in Brazil peaked at 43,850 Cases in 2013 and was at its lowest, 18 Cases, in 1982.

Brazil ranks 1st of 34 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

This dataset presents time series on Acquired Immunodeficiency Syndrome (AIDS), for the number of AIDS cases and incidence rates per 100 000 population at year of diagnosis. It also includes data on incidence of pertussis, measles, and hepatitis B, in terms of rates of reported cases per 100 000 population.
